Lookout Mountain Golf Club
Played On 12/11/2016Tricky greens! Lots of undulation.
Stayed at the Hilton for a week and played this course every day with my husband. The course is in excellent condition....but beware, it is TARGET GOLF. Miss the fairway..you are in trouble...and you have probably lost a ball. The greens are difficult to read and to get the speed correct is a real challenge. A couple of 3 putts here and there..LOL. Don't think about walking because it is very very hilly and steep. Long distances between holes as well. The carts are in good shape however do not have GPS's. Bring a rangefinder..have fun. We did!

Avila Beach Golf Resort
Played On 08/13/2015fairways and green good condition...but....
Always enjoy playing this course when in the area, however, the practice facilities are terrible. The "range" is AWFUL. There is no chipping practice area. The putting practice area is small. HOWEVER, ON THE PLUS SIDE...the course has interesting and somewhat challenging holes but is fair! It can get quite warm in the afternoon...so try to get out by 9AM the latest OR wait until 5 or so....It is a good value for the $$$$
We prefer to play by ourselves as a couple and they have always been able to ensure that for us. A round of 18 will usually take somewhere between 4 and 4 1/2 hours which is fine with us. Try to go during the week and it will be a very nice experience for you. We are retired and play during the week only so I have no idea of what it is like on the week-end.
